I buy Atlas 451's Thermal Fit on ebay a few dozen at a time. The last order cost me $1.66 per pair, delivered. The seller was bigblockbiscayne [email protected] and I've ordered from him several times. We wear them summer and winter, wash them after each use. They hold up well and when they start to show wear they go into the greasy work bin where they get used and tossed.

The best deals on bulk gloves are at Galeton. They apparently make their own, and sell a lot of other stuff too. I get earplugs from them, too.

http://www.galeton.com/webapp/wcs/s...oreId=10601&catalogId=10101&topCategory=10679

They have WAY more glove varieties than you will ever need. Some are double cheap with double-cheap quality, others are mighty-pricey. You will always get your money's worth.

Good customer service, too. They have sent me quite a few free pair (with an order) just to try out a different variety.
